GMF Cycle 3

    From Greater Milwaukee Foundation

    The Greater Milwaukee Foundation aims to enhance the quality of life in the Greater Milwaukee area by addressing local needs and fostering community improvement through support and funding to a wide range of initiatives and programs, primarily focusing on basic human needs, community development, education, and the arts.

    Type of Support

    Overview

    The grant program by the Greater Milwaukee Foundation for 2024 seeks to support projects, capital, and general operating requests that align with multiple funding priorities. These priorities include Arts and Culture, Aging and Older Adults, Early Childhood Education, Entrepreneurship and Small Business Development, Environment, and Healthy Birth Outcomes. The grant aims to explore partnership opportunities with grantee agencies, advised fund donors, and other funders to achieve its goals in the specified areas, notably focusing on supporting visual, performing, and multidisciplinary arts, as well as arts education; aging in place and fostering intergenerational connections; improving the quality and access to early childhood education; providing resources and technical assistance to small businesses; conserving environmental assets and strengthening food systems; and addressing maternal/child health disparities.
